The Arthritis Score in 21163, Woodstock, Maryland is 92 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

88.35 percent of the population in 21163 drive to work alone. 3.77 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 46.35 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 12.30 percent of the residents in 21163 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.60 members with about 2.21 cars available per household.

An estimate of 95.73 percent of the residents in 21163 has some form of health insurance. 33.14 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 78.77 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 21163 would have to travel an average of 4.79 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Northwest Hospital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 21163, Woodstock, Maryland.

As of , an estimate of 6,891 residents live in 21163 with a median age of 46.0 years. 22.26 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 20.82 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 45.28 percent of the residents in 21163 is currently married, and 17.91 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 21163 is $11,736.08.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 21163 is approximately $2,174. The median household spends about 18.52 percent of their income on housing.
